Match Preview: Setting the Stage for a High-Stakes Encounter
As of August 2025, the playoff between Greece’s PAOK and Croatia’s Rijeka stands delicately poised. Rijeka clinched a 1-0 victory at home in the first leg, thanks to a goal by Bosnian midfielder Luka Menalo. This narrow margin sets up a compelling second leg at PAOK’s fortress, the Toumba Stadium in Thessaloniki.
PAOK boasts an impressive home unbeaten streak spanning seven competitive matches with six wins and a draw, bolstered by five clean sheets during this run. Their defensive solidity and passionate home support make them formidable, but their attack has shown inconsistency. Rijeka, coming off a knockout from the Champions League qualifiers, are eager to solidify their Europa League credentials. Yet, their recent form is shaky, with two consecutive home defeats dampening morale.
This clash isn’t just about skill; it’s a strategic tug-of-war where Rijeka’s efficiency on the counter and PAOK’s home advantage create a spicy recipe. With both teams close to squad strength but missing a few key players to injuries, tactical discipline and composure will be paramount.
Tactical Battle: Can Rijeka Defend Their Lead?
Rijeka’s approach in the first leg was disciplined and efficient, dominating possession (66%) and outshooting PAOK with seven shots on target to two, reflecting their intent to control the game. Despite this, their recent defensive vulnerabilities and lower scoring rate in past fixtures raise questions on their capacity to hold PAOK back on hostile turf.
PAOK, known for their tactical flexibility, will likely employ an aggressive pressing game to unsettle Rijeka early. However, they must balance attack with caution to avoid conceding a costly away goal. The likelihood is a closely contested affair with under 2.5 goals expected, where the first goal could prove decisive.
For Rijeka, maintaining a tight defensive structure and exploiting counterattacks through speedy transitions will be crucial. Effective communication and minimizing errors—illustrated by the injury absence of defender Mile Skoric—could tip the scales.
PAOK’s Home Advantage: Fan Energy and Tactical Discipline
The Toumba Stadium’s intimidating atmosphere has historically been a fortress for PAOK. The passionate fanbase, known for their unwavering support, will play a psychological role. PAOK head coach Razvan Lucescu’s men have thrived under this pressure, making home games tough for opponents.
PAOK’s defensive record at home is sterling, conceding just once this season and boasting multiple clean sheets. This defensive resilience offers a strong foundation to push for the goals they need to overturn the tie.
